scope:
1.1 These test methods cover the determination of manganese in iron ores, concentrates, and agglomerates. The following two test methods are included:
Sections | |
Test Method A (Pyrophosphate (Potentiometric)) | 8 - 15 |
Test Method B (Periodate (Photometric)) | 16 - 22 |
1.2 Test Method A covers the determination of manganese in the range from 2.5 % to 15.0 %. Test Method B covers the determination of manganese in the range of 0.01 % to 5.00 %.
Note 1: The lower limit for this test method is set at 50 % relative error for the lowest grade material tested in the interlaboratory study in accordance with Practice E1601.
